37:30Now PlayingFam, Let's talk about the money ... especially the money that public HBCUs should be getting to help keep them afloat and to give them an opportunity to thrive.
With the help of Dr. Ben Chavis and attorney Alvin Chambliss, Roland Martin is joining the movement and call for save our Historically Black Colleges and Universities.
On August 14th, 2021 we will March to Save our HBCUs (stay tuned for details).
On Friday, Consultant Attorney Alvin Chambliss spoke with Roland Martin about the battle to secure funding for HBCUs, obstacles he has faced while advocating for these institutions and what we as a community can do to ensure that HBCUs continue to serve our community.
